A non-coder used Claude to build a photo recipe preview app

Fujifilm camera recipes are often shared with beautiful sample photos, but they can look very different when applied to someone else’s own photos. A small app was built with Claude in about 45 minutes to solve that problem.

The app lets a person upload a photo, apply camera recipe changes, and see the result live. The screen puts the photo at the top and the controls underneath in a scrollable area.

It also includes a button to change the photo, a way to save recipes, a recipes view, and an export option for a recipe card. The maker had no coding knowledge and created it through a back-and-forth prompt conversation with Claude for a React app.
